Black Forest Labs, the startup behind Grok’s image generator, releases an API
Black Forest Labs, the startup behind the controversial image generation capabilities of xAI's Grok assistant, has released a new model and beta API.
Image Credits: Black Forest LabsBlack Forest Labs, which is based in Germany and recently came out of stealth with $31 million in seed funding, was co-founded by the engineers who built the technology behind Stability AI, including Andreas Blattmann, Patrick Esser, Dominik Lorenz and CEO Robin Rombach. The startup became the subject of controversy after its deal with xAI to build Flux into Grok without safety guardrails, which resulted in a torrent of outrageous — and atrocious — images. Black Forest Labs, whose other backers include Y Combinator CEO Garry Tan and former Oculus CEO Brendan Iribe, is developing a video generation model, and is said to be in the process of raising $100 million at a $1 billion valuation — a significant jump up from its previous $150 million valuation.
